We are looking for an IT Cloud Infrastructure Administrator to support production environments and infrastructure delivery within an Agile and DevOps organisation.
You will help ensure that production requirements are considered throughout the project lifecycle—from solution design and backlog definition to deployment, monitoring, incident resolution, and continuous improvement.
The role combines infrastructure operations, container platforms, observability, DevOps practices, security, and production reliability. You will work closely with development, infrastructure, security, and production-support teams to deliver stable and well-monitored services.
